What is the Tide Pods Class Action Lawsuit?

The Tide Pods class action lawsuit alleges that the packaging of these laundry detergent packets is defective, making them easily accessible to children. The lawsuit aims to compensate individuals and families who have been affected by these incidents. It seeks to hold Procter & Gamble, the manufacturer of Tide Pods, accountable for the alleged design flaws and inadequate warnings.
